 | /* | 
 |  * Support /proc/cpuinfo | 
 |  */ | 
 |  | 
 | #define cpu_to_ptr(n) ((void *)((long)(n)+1)) | 
 | #define ptr_to_cpu(p) ((long)(p) - 1) | 
 |  | 
 | static int show_cpuinfo(struct seq_file *m, void *v) | 
 | { | 
 | 	int n = ptr_to_cpu(v); | 
 |  | 
 | 	if (n == 0) { | 
 | 		char buf[NR_CPUS*5]; | 
 | 		cpulist_scnprintf(buf, sizeof(buf), cpu_online_mask); | 
 | 		seq_printf(m, "cpu count\t: %d\n", num_online_cpus()); | 
 | 		seq_printf(m, "cpu list\t: %s\n", buf); | 
 | 		seq_printf(m, "model name\t: %s\n", chip_model); | 
 | 		seq_printf(m, "flags\t\t:\n");  /* nothing for now */ | 
 | 		seq_printf(m, "cpu MHz\t\t: %llu.%06llu\n", | 
 | 			   get_clock_rate() / 1000000, | 
 | 			   (get_clock_rate() % 1000000)); | 
 | 		seq_printf(m, "bogomips\t: %lu.%02lu\n\n", | 
 | 			   loops_per_jiffy/(500000/HZ), | 
 | 			   (loops_per_jiffy/(5000/HZ)) % 100); | 
 | 	} | 
 |  | 
 | #ifdef CONFIG_SMP | 
 | 	if (!cpu_online(n)) | 
 | 		return 0; | 
 | #endif | 
 |  | 
 | 	seq_printf(m, "processor\t: %d\n", n); | 
 |  | 
 | 	/* Print only num_online_cpus() blank lines total. */ | 
 | 	if (cpumask_next(n, cpu_online_mask) < nr_cpu_ids) | 
 | 		seq_printf(m, "\n"); | 
 |  | 
 | 	return 0; | 
 | } | 
 |  | 
 | static void *c_start(struct seq_file *m, loff_t *pos) | 
 | { | 
 | 	return *pos < nr_cpu_ids ? cpu_to_ptr(*pos) : NULL; | 
 | } | 
 | static void *c_next(struct seq_file *m, void *v, loff_t *pos) | 
 | { | 
 | 	++*pos; | 
 | 	return c_start(m, pos); | 
 | } | 
 | static void c_stop(struct seq_file *m, void *v) | 
 | { | 
 | } | 
 | const struct seq_operations cpuinfo_op = { | 
 | 	.start	= c_start, | 
 | 	.next	= c_next, | 
 | 	.stop	= c_stop, | 
 | 	.show	= show_cpuinfo, | 
 | }; |
